DESCRIPTION:Join us a for an evening with our Village campers from around the world!\nWho Can Attend?\nThe More the Merrier! Please RSVP and invite friends and family. \nWhat is a Village Camp?\nThe CISV Village programme is a four-week camp that brings together children from 11 countries to live\, play\, and learn together\, building friendships and understanding across language and cultural differences. This summer\, Jacksonville is hosting 44 eleven-year-old youth from eleven countries for our month-long Village camp. Our international guests represent China\, Denmark\, Ecuador\, Guatemala\, Iceland\, Italy\, Mexico\, Norway\, Portugal\, Sweden\, and the USA. \nWhat is Open Day?\nAt Open Day\, each delegation will present their culture through traditional dances and performances\, followed by an interactive expo where guests can engage with the children and learn about their countries. This family-friendly event offers our community a unique opportunity to welcome these young international visitors. \nWhere is Open Day?\nOpen Day will take place in the Riverside neighborhood of Jacksonville. DESCRIPTION:CISV Jacksonville conducts three events to select participants for its Village program (children born between September 1\, 2013\, and August 31\, 2014) and Faces program (4th or 5th-grade students in the 2024-25 school year): \n\nTwo Saturday Morning “Play Days”\nOne Friday Night Overnight (Mandatory)\n\nAttending more events increases the likelihood of selection. The overnight event is mandatory. \nThese selection events offer children a glimpse into CISV games and activities\, provide parents with a deeper understanding of CISV’s educational principles and program specifics\, and allow our chapter to familiarize itself with youth and leader applicants. \nWe also host a CISV “101” Info Session for adults to gain insights into CISV’s principles. \nThe Village and Faces Programs aim to foster understanding\, communication\, cooperation\, and communal living. Selection criteria include a child’s maturity\, openness to new experiences and people\, enthusiasm for participation\, and the ability to be away from family during the program. The composition of personalities within the delegation is also considered for a balanced mix. \nActivities are typically planned and led by teenage leaders from the Junior Branch and experienced adult leaders. Planning selection events enables our chapter’s youth leaders to hone their leadership skills. \nAll Village applicants and their parents will undergo interviews during one of the selection events. DESCRIPTION:We are very excited to announce Atlanta will be hosting the South East Regional mini camp Nov 8th 2023 7:00 PM through Nov 10th  2024 2:00 PM. \nWhat is Mini Camp?\nMini Camp is an incredible weekend; jam-packed with fun CISV activities\, top notch educational content\, awesome people\, energizers galore\, and so much more! Our awesome CISV Atlanta Junior Branch Board are planning an amazing mini camp for you. \nA mini camp is a 2-3 day program organized by a local chapter that imitates what it would be like to spend time at a national or international CISV program. It brings together experienced CISV participants and others\, that may be new to CISV\, to learn what CISV is all about. It is a fun weekend that aims to build cross-cultural understanding\, empathy\, and peace.
